(1) An Accused who is acquitted shall not be required to pay costs.
(2) Such costs shall be defrayed by the public treasury where the prosecution was initiated by
the Legal Department.
(3) They shall be borne by the civil party where prosecution was initiated by him.
(4) However, the court may by a reasoned judgment, exempt the civil party who acted in good
faith from the payment of ail or part of the cost.
